  1. I captured an avi file using windv, it is a dv-avi file.

    I then used avi2dvd to create the vob files. When i load the dv-avi file, avi2dvd says that it cannot work with dv-avi file and needs to convert it to a normal one using one of 2 codecs, cedocida and panasonic.

    Having installed cedocida, the resulting avi file from the conversion has no sound.

    The original dv-avi file was captured as a type-1 avi.

    What am i doing wrong?

    Download the canopus DV convertor from the tools section and convert to type II. You might also need to install the panasonic DV codec
